Be A Berean By Mark WoodsThe Solid Rock This week, we will look at 1 John 4:1-6. In this passage John addresses the false ideas that some people had about who Jesus was. John warns his readers that we should not just accept without discernment what people say about Jesus. It's easy to think that because someone talks about Jesus, they must be a believer. We need to be more discerning than that. The fact is, there is a spirit of AntiChrist in the world, and it is at work to sow confusion and disinformation about our faith. If this spirit can cause Christians to become confused in their thinking, it will lead people away from the faith. So first of all, we need to use our powers of discernment when listening to what others are saying about Jesus. Secondly, we need to resist the spirit of deception that is at work to lead us astray. Lastly, we need to declare the victory we have. There are many Christians who live scared, confused and defeated lives. John says that we are the victorious ones. We have the victory over the world by the Spirit that lives in us. That means we can be confident, joyous and courageous in life. We are not sloshing around in miry clay, slipping and sliding our way through life. We have our feet standing on solid ground. We are walking a straight path. We are moving towards a glorious future. Don't let any deception convince you otherwise! As John later says: "everyone born of God overcomes the world. This is the victory that has overcome the world, even our faith."
